Output 668e05e77f0562b19392d1aeed9768cfc413f66ca6afbcbc3ebe42e9ff12c889:0

value
114301
script pubkey
OP_0 OP_PUSHBYTES_20 077be67bb9507bb1ac9252d81c57923d17c04dd6
address
bc1qqaa7v7ae2pamrtyj2tvpc4uj85tuqnwkhyhjzl
transaction
668e05e77f0562b19392d1aeed9768cfc413f66ca6afbcbc3ebe42e9ff12c889
confirmations
14080
spent
true